Digital Storytelling Guide for Educators
$5.95-$18.49, Amazon
Bring the age-old art of storytelling into the 21st century by using digital storytelling. With tools available on most computers, students can create their own digital stories—sounds, animations, videos and all. Learn how to unleash your modern students’ creativity with this important edtech book.

Teaching With the Tools Kids Really Use: Learning With Web and Mobile Technologies
$2-$25, Amazon
Engage your students using relevant content and technology tools that they already love using outside the classroom. This book comes with a decision-making model, to help you choose the best tools, along with other recommended resources and support tips specifically for K-12 classrooms.

Curriculum 21: Essential Education for a Changing World
$4-$20, Amazon
Is your curriculum preparing students for the ever-changing 21st century? Author and educator Heidi Hayes asks all the right questions to provoke serious thought and conversation about how teachers and administrators can improve their curriculum to better serve the modern students they’re teaching.
